017fa3e891 minmax: simplify and clarify min_t()/max_t() implementation
This simplifies the min_t() and max_t() macros by no longer making them
work in the context of a C constant expression.

That means that you can no longer use them for static initializers or
for array sizes in type definitions, but there were only a couple of
such uses, and all of them were converted (famous last words) to use
MIN_T/MAX_T instead.

4477b39c32 minmax: add a few more MIN_T/MAX_T users
Commit 3a7e02c040 ("minmax: avoid overly complicated constant
expressions in VM code") added the simpler MIN_T/MAX_T macros in order
to avoid some excessive expansion from the rather complicated regular
min/max macros.

The complexity of those macros stems from two issues:

 (a) trying to use them in situations that require a C constant
     expression (in static initializers and for array sizes)

 (b) the type sanity checking

and MIN_T/MAX_T avoids both of these issues.

Now, in the whole (long) discussion about all this, it was pointed out
that the whole type sanity checking is entirely unnecessary for
min_t/max_t which get a fixed type that the comparison is done in.

But that still leaves min_t/max_t unnecessarily complicated due to
worries about the C constant expression case.

However, it turns out that there really aren't very many cases that use
min_t/max_t for this, and we can just force-convert those.

This does exactly that.

Which in turn will then allow for much simpler implementations of
min_t()/max_t().  All the usual "macros in all upper case will evaluate
the arguments multiple times" rules apply.

We should do all the same things for the regular min/max() vs MIN/MAX()
cases, but that has the added complexity of various drivers defining
their own local versions of MIN/MAX, so that needs another level of
fixes first.

3415b10a03 kbuild: Fix '-S -c' in x86 stack protector scripts
After a recent change in clang to stop consuming all instances of '-S'
and '-c' [1], the stack protector scripts break due to the kernel's use
of -Werror=unused-command-line-argument to catch cases where flags are
not being properly consumed by the compiler driver:

  $ echo | clang -o - -x c - -S -c -Werror=unused-command-line-argument
  clang: error: argument unused during compilation: '-c' [-Werror,-Wunused-command-line-argument]

This results in CONFIG_STACKPROTECTOR getting disabled because
CONFIG_CC_HAS_SANE_STACKPROTECTOR is no longer set.

'-c' and '-S' both instruct the compiler to stop at different stages of
the pipeline ('-S' after compiling, '-c' after assembling), so having
them present together in the same command makes little sense. In this
case, the test wants to stop before assembling because it is looking at
the textual assembly output of the compiler for either '%fs' or '%gs',
so remove '-c' from the list of arguments to resolve the error.

All versions of GCC continue to work after this change, along with
versions of clang that do or do not contain the change mentioned above.

ba6c664081 kbuild: rpm-pkg: Fix C locale setup
semicolon separation in LC_ALL is wrong. Either variable needs to be
exported before as a separate commit or set as part of the commit in the
beginning. Used second variant.

This fixes broken build on user's locale setup which makes 'date' binary
to produce invalid characters in rpm changelog (e.g. cs_CZ.UTF-8 'čec'):

$ make binrpm-pkg
  GEN     rpmbuild/SPECS/kernel.spec
rpmbuild -bb rpmbuild/SPECS/kernel.spec --define='_topdirlinux/rpmbuild' \
    --target x86_64-linux --build-in-place --noprep --define='_smp_mflags \
    %{nil}' $(rpm -q rpm >/dev/null 2>&1 || echo --nodeps)
Building target platforms: x86_64-linux
Building for target x86_64-linux
error: bad date in %changelog: St čec 24 2024 user <user@somehost>
make[2]: *** [scripts/Makefile.package:71: binrpm-pkg] Error 1
make[1]: *** [linux/Makefile:1546: binrpm-pkg] Error 2
make: *** [Makefile:224: __sub-make] Error 2
